Innate lymphoid cells (ILCs) are part of a heterogeneous family of innate immune
cells with newly identified roles in mediating immunity, tissue homeostasis, and
pathologic inflammation. Here, we review recent studies delineating the roles of
ILCs in the pathogenesis of multiple inflammatory skin disorders and their unique
effector functions. Finally, we address how these studies have informed our
understanding of the regulation of ILCs and the therapeutic potential of
targeting these cells in the context of skin inflammation.
